For component-level repair, use:
| Section | What It Shows | |---------|----------------| | | PM6150/PM6150L ICs, battery connector, charging path, boost converters | | Processor & Memory | Snapdragon 732G pinout, LPDDR4X RAM, UFS 2.2 storage connections | | Display | AMOLED driver IC (S6E3HC2), touch controller, backlight (if applicable) | | Camera System | 108MP main sensor (HM2), 8MP ultrawide, 5MP macro, 2MP depth – plus MIPI CSI lanes | | Audio | Smart PA (AW87338), headphone jack (if present), dual microphone path | | RF & Wireless | Wi-Fi/BT (WCN3998), GNSS, 4G LTE power amplifier, antenna switches | | Sensors | Proximity, ambient light, accelerometer/gyroscope (ICM-4xxxx) | | Connectors & Buttons | USB Type-C, SIM tray, volume/power flex pinouts | Do you have a specific Redmi Note 10 Pro repair story
The Redmi Note 10 Pro schematic diagram PDF is a powerful tool for advanced repair and learning phone hardware design. While not necessary for everyday fixes, it becomes invaluable when diagnosing dead boards, missing voltage rails, or corrupted peripheral lines. Always obtain schematics responsibly, use proper safety gear, and respect copyright laws.
